Take
the Local Harvest Challenge
The
Local
Harvest Challenge is running from the 1st - 7th April.
It's one week where people actively seek to eat local
foods, support growers and learn more about where their
food comes from.
Join up as a class and choose a Bite-Sized,
Meal-Sized or Feast-Sized challenge to suit you. Use the
Local Harvest website to find resources close to you. Blog
your discoveries and experiences, learn from others. Sign
up at localharvest.org.au.

Fundraise
with the 'Ethical Shopping Guide'
You
can help your class and school community make the connections
between the issues they care about and the things they
buy on a daily basis.
Last year many schools successfully raised
money by selling our pocket-guide 'The Guide to
Ethical Supermarket Shopping'. This guide explores
the companies behind common brands and introduces the many
issues connected with our everyday purchases. Your dollar
can be a vote for a better world! See more about using
the guide for fundraising.
